MEMO — Kettling Depot Receiving

Uniform sets for the new Kettling depot arrive Wednesday via Ashgrove courier: 40 boxes, sorted by size, manifest attached to box one. Check the count at the dock before signing; shortages go straight to stores, not the courier. The hand-over instruction the courier will follow is set out below.

drop instructions, tafof-baguf: the holmir gilox courier leaves the sormir ulaok holdor ledger at gate 5596 under passcode 257343

## Configuration

The Nodlight consent banner rollout is controlled entirely through the env file shipped with each deploy. Rollout percentage, region allowlist, and banner variant are all plain values you can adjust during an incident without a rebuild; the service re-reads the file every 60 seconds. Flag evaluation calls out to the Tallygate service, which requires authentication. That credential must be present at startup or the banner falls back to the legacy variant. It is set on the following line.

secret setting of yagef-baweg: RELAY_SECRET29=cb53deb59a49ed54d9f43599b54ca

HANDOVER — Lattermill template rendering performance

I'm rotating off, so here's the state of play for plugin authors. The render hot path now caches compiled templates per locale; invalidation triggers on manifest version bump only. Partial includes deeper than four levels still hit the slow path — a fix is sketched in the perf branch but unreviewed. Benchmarks live in the perf harness repo. Ongoing ownership of rendering performance sits with the engineer named below.

named custodian: Brivan Eliath Quenox Frador